Flex Fee Overview
Flex Fee gives you the ability to add customizable transaction fees to member purchases. This allows you to support community initiatives, offset operational costs, or create financial buffers—all on your terms. The goal is to provide greater control and flexibility over your business finances.
Setting Up Flex Fees
To enable and configure Flex Fees:
Log in to your PushPress Dashboard.
Navigate to Settings → Flex Fees.
Choose whether the Flex Fee applies to Credit Card (CC) transactions, ACH transactions, or both.
Set your desired percentage fee (up to 10%) for the selected payment types.
Note: Flex Fees are only available on Pro and Max plans. Free plan users will not see this option.
Flex Fee FAQs
What is the maximum Flex Fee I can set?
You can set a Flex Fee of up to 10%.
Who receives the proceeds from Flex Fees?
Your business receives 100% of the Flex Fee. PushPress does not collect any portion.
Example:
A plan costs $100, and you set a 7% Flex Fee.
The client pays: $107
Stripe processing fee: $3
Your business receives: $104
Do Flex Fees replace other processing fee setups?
Yes. Enabling Flex Fees replaces any pre-existing fee configurations to ensure no double charging occurs.
Will customers see the Flex Fee during checkout?
Visibility depends on the purchase flow:
Manually Created Invoices
When an admin creates an invoice in the backend, the Flex Fee appears only on the final invoice after payment is completed.
Landing Page Purchases
For purchases made through a landing page (with standard email/password checkout), the Flex Fee is visible at checkout as part of the total before payment is submitted.
Can I apply Flex Fees to memberships only?
Not at this time.
When a Flex Fee is enabled, it applies to all transactions processed via the selected payment method. It cannot be restricted to specific member groups, services, or products.
Invoice Combining for Cost Efficiency
PushPress helps reduce processing fees by allowing consolidated charges:
Immediate Processing
Product invoices process immediately unless an auto bill date is set.
Consolidated Invoices
Members with auto-charge dates may have product purchases and membership dues merged into one combined invoice, reducing transaction fees and simplifying billing.
Flex Fee Settings Access & Troubleshooting
Flex Fee settings are visible only to Pro and Max plan users.
If you don’t see the option:
You may need to upgrade your subscription
The feature may be temporarily inaccessible during system updates
In these cases, Pro/Max users can access the legacy settings page via the link provided in the dashboard
Additional FAQs
Will enabling Flex Fees double-charge members?
No. Only one fee (Flex Fee or any previous setup) will be applied.
Can Flex Fees pass credit card processing fees directly to members?
Flex Fees cannot directly pass card processing fees through to members.
If you're looking to offset processing costs, consider adjusting:
Membership rates
Setup fees
Applicable taxes
Best Practices for Implementing Flex Fees
1. Assess Costs
Calculate your average transaction fees to determine a reasonable Flex Fee percentage.
2. Stay Competitive
Check how other gyms in your area handle add-on charges. High fees may affect your competitive position.
3. Prioritize Transparency
Be clear with members about why the fee is being applied. This helps maintain trust and reduces confusion.
4. Monitor Feedback
Pay attention to member reactions. Negative feedback may indicate the need to adjust your approach.
5. Ensure Legal Compliance
Research local laws around surcharges to ensure your fee structure aligns with regulatory requirements.
6. Use Flex Fees Strategically
Consider Flex Fees a last resort after exploring other ways to control costs.
7. Educate Your Staff
Make sure your team understands how Flex Fees work and can communicate them accurately.
8. Review Regularly
Transaction fees and business needs change. Reevaluate your Flex Fee setup periodically.By following these best practices, you can effectively implement the Flex Fee Feature in a way that supports your business while maintaining a positive relationship with your gym members.
Help
If you would like more information or need further assistance, please use our HELP DOCs, just like this one or reach out through intercom, the little blue box in your CORE account or email us at support@pushpress.com. Our team is here to help.
About PushPress
PushPress is a gym management software that can help you a lot in managing your gym. We've helped thousands of local gyms streamline and professionalize their businesses with our intuitive, powerful solution for managing fitness facilities - all from the palm of their hands! Want to take charge? Give us 3 minutes on the phone or schedule an in-person demo today!
